Installing tie rod

NOTE: Water can leak in if sealing elements are damaged.
  • Component can become damaged or may not function.

→ Replace damaged sealing elements.

→ Check that sealing elements are fitted correctly.

Information 

Carry out a close visual inspection of all parts.

The inner clamp must be replaced.

When fitting the ball joints, ensure that the bevel pinions are clean. Remove dirt or grease on bevel pinions, e.g. with a lint-free cloth. Do not use cleaning agent/solvent.

Information 

Information 

  1. Fit tie rod -2-  on the rack-and-pinion by tightening the octagon -1-  . Tightening torque 100 Nm (74 ft. lb.) 

    Make sure that no damage (scoring or similar damage) is caused to the rack-and-pinion.

  2. Fit new bellows and secure with new clamps.

    Make sure it fits perfectly both on the steering-gear housing and on the tie rod.

    1. 2.1. Push on bellows until you hear and feel it engaging securely on the tie rod.

      Dimension -a-  must be 2 mm.

    2. 2.2. Fit new outer clamp using spring band clamp pliers WE 1646  .

    3. 2.3. Fit new inner clamp using clamp tensioner.

      During fitting, make sure that the bellows is not twisted and that the clamp lug is easy to reach.

      1. 2.3.1. Fit clamp tensioner -1-  as shown. Make sure that the blades of the tensioner are positioned in the corners of the clamp.

        Tighten clamp by turning the spindle using a torque wrench -2-  . Do not tilt the tensioner while doing this.

        Make sure that the thread of the spindle on the clamp tensioner -1-  can move freely. Lubricate with MoS2 lubricant if necessary.

        If it is stiff, e.g. due to dirt on the thread, the required clamping force of the clamp will not be achieved.

        Observe the specified tightening torque:

    Type of clamp Clamp tensioner V.A.G 1682 A (Hazet) with adapter V.A.G 1682 A/1
    Clamp on passenger's side (diameter: 85 mm) Tightening torque 7 Nm (5 ft. lb.) 
    Clamp on driver's side (diameter: 59 mm) Tightening torque 10 Nm (7.5 ft. lb.)
